Welcome to Almost, Maine, a town that’s so far north, it’s almost not in the United States—it’s almost in Canada. And it almost doesn’t exist. Because its residents never got around to getting organized. So it’s just…Almost.

One cold, clear Friday night in the middle of winter, while the northern lights hover in the sky above, Almost’s residents find themselves falling in and out of love in the strangest ways. Knees are bruised. Hearts are broken. Love is lost, found, and confounded. And life for the people of Almost, Maine will never be the same.

ALMOST, MAINE: It’s love. But not quite.

The Directors’ Workshop is an educational workshop that presents four weekend performances a year in the Cattell Theatre. Ed Wavak is chair of the Directors' Workshop committee and Greg Kolack, TWS Artist-in-Residence, is the Directors' Workshop Mentor.

Chicago's own WGN TV sportscaster is heading back to TWS for another wild and not ready for family time stand-up show.

A sports anchor and reporter, Pat Tomasulo joined WGN-TV in 2005 and quickly became a fan favorite. He is one of the main hosts on the top-rated WGN Morning News, creating signature segments like “The Pat-Down” and “The Voice of Reason.” He’s also an accomplished standup comedian, performing in shows across the country.
